Meryl Gordon, the author of four biographies, will be discussing the rollicking life and political legacy of Perle Mesta, the diplomat and hostess who was close to four presidents and in-demand for four decades.
Bio: Meryl Gordon, an award-winning journalist and professor, has written four biographies about distinguished and influential women: Mrs. Astor Regrets; The Phantom of Fifth Avenue; Bunny Mellon: The Life of an American Style Legend; and her latest, The Woman Who Knew Everyone. A native of Rochester, NY and graduate of the University of Michigan, Meryl is a tenured journalism professor at New York University. She has written for The New York Times, New York Magazine, Vanity Fair and Town & Country.
